WebJun 23, 2024 · Myasthenia gravis happens when your immune system -- your body's defense against germs -- makes antibodies that disrupt nerve signals. The result is that your muscles get weak. It usually... WebDec 30, 2024 · Myasthenia gravis (MG) is an autoimmune neuromuscular disease that affects the muscles in the body. It's a chronic disease that causes certain muscles to become very weak when they are being used for a period of time, but then return to normal strength after the muscles have a chance to rest. The name comes from Greek and Latin words meaning "grave muscle weakness." But most cases of MG are not as "grave" as the name implies. In fact, most people with MG can expect to live normal lives. bing trying to hijack my browserWebSep 17, 2024 · How is myasthenia gravis diagnosed?
